Tanzanian Govt Hits Back at Ruto After Controversial Remarks

The Tanzanian government has refuted claims made by Kenyan President William Ruto regarding the extent of road infrastructure in neighboring East African countries.

  • Ruto stated Kenya has 20,000 kilometers of tarmacked roads, more than the combined total of Uganda, Tanzania, DRC, Rwanda, Burundi, and South Sudan.
  • A Tanzanian minister countered that Tanzania alone has 16,000 kilometers of tarmac roads, and the regional total exceeds 22,000 kilometers.
  • The dispute arose as Ruto attempted to justify higher fuel prices in Kenya due to its extensive road network.
